Seven die in Cement factory collapse, mob turn violent
Jaipur, Sep 3 (UNI) Seven people were killed and two injured when a portion of an unfinished construction in Grasim cement factory caved in, in Kotputli in Jaipur district early this morning.
Police said while five people died on the spot, two succumbed to injuries later. One injured was admitted to kotputli hospital and the other was being treated at the SMS hospital here.
Later a mob of factory labourers and locals protesting against the owners alleged apathy towards the victims, indulged in violence, pelted stones and damaged some vehicles outside the factory premises.
